WALDEN v. UNITED STATES

No. 7844.

106 F.2d 611 (1939)

WALDEN v. UNITED STATES.

Circuit Court of Appeals, Sixth Circuit.

September 18, 1939.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Vincent E. Schoeck, of Detroit, Mich. (Vincent E. Schoeck, of Detroit, Mich., on the brief), for appellant.

Thomas E. Walsh, of Washington, D. C. (John C. Lehr and Francis X. Norris, both of Detroit, Mich., and Julius C. Martin, Wilbur C. Pickett and Fendall Marbury, all of Washington, D. C., on the brief), for the United States.

Before HICKS, SIMONS, and HAMILTON, Circuit Judges.


HICKS, Circuit Judge.

Suit upon a War Risk term insurance policy. Appellee moved to dismiss upon the ground that the action was barred by the Statute of Limitations. The appeal is from an order sustaining the motion.

The record is unsatisfactory from many viewpoints but we treat the case as it was presented to the District Court and here.
